Abbey Rangers
_No League Soccer

Abbey Rangers

England · Est. 1976

About Abbey Rangers

Abbey Rangers Football Club is a football club based in Addlestone, England. The club are currently members of the Combined Counties League Premier Division South and play at Addlestone Moor.